Sidewalk graffiti removal services involve the thorough cleaning and removal of unwanted markings, paint, or stickers from concrete, brick, or stone surfaces. These services typically utilize specialized cleaning agents, pressure washing, or other techniques designed to eliminate graffiti without damaging the underlying material. The goal is to restore the appearance of sidewalks, walkways, and public pathways, making them look clean and well-maintained. These services are essential for property owners who want to maintain a neat and welcoming environment, especially in areas where graffiti can quickly become a visual distraction or detract from the property's overall appeal.

Graffiti on sidewalks can pose several problems for property owners and communities. It often creates an unkempt or neglected look, which can influence perceptions of safety and property value. For businesses, graffiti may discourage customers or visitors, while homeowners might find it unsightly and difficult to ignore. Additionally, graffiti can sometimes be associated with vandalism or unauthorized activity, leading property owners to seek professional removal to discourage further incidents. Removing graffiti promptly helps maintain a positive image and can prevent the need for more extensive or costly repairs later on.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Graffiti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or graffiti removal on sidewalks generally range from $100 to $300.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the graffiti and surface type.

Medium Projects - For more extensive graffiti covering larger sidewalk sections, local contractors often charge between $300 and $600. Projects in this range are common for moderate-scale removal efforts.

Large-Scale Cleanup - Larger or more complex graffiti removal jobs can cost from $600 to $1,200 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, usually involving multiple surfaces or difficult-to-remove markings.

Full Surface Replacement - Complete sidewalk surface replacements due to extensive damage or persistent graffiti can exceed $5,000. These projects are less frequent and typically involve significant repair or reconstruction work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of graffiti can local contractors remove from sidewalks? They can typically remove various types of graffiti, including spray paint, markers, and stickers, from concrete and paved surfaces.

Are sidewalk graffiti removal services suitable for all sidewalk materials? Most service providers can handle graffiti removal on common sidewalk materials like concrete and asphalt, but it's best to check if they can work with specific surface types.

What methods do local contractors use to remove graffiti from sidewalks? They often use specialized cleaning techniques such as pressure washing, chemical cleaning, or a combination of both to effectively remove graffiti.

Can sidewalk graffiti be removed without damaging the surface? Experienced service providers aim to remove graffiti while preserving the integrity of the sidewalk surface, using appropriate cleaning methods for each situation.

How do local contractors ensure the removal process is effective? They assess the type of graffiti and sidewalk material to choose the most suitable removal method, ensuring thorough cleaning without surface damage.
